O Que é Um Qhull?

Advertisements

Scipy. A espacial pode calcular triangulações, diagramas de voronoi e cascos convexos de um conjunto de pontos , aproveitando a biblioteca Qhull. Além disso, ele contém implementações de Kdtree para consultas de ponto de vizinha mais próximo e serviços públicos para cálculos de distância em várias métricas.

O que você quer dizer com casco convexo?

O casco convexo é A linha que envolve completamente um conjunto de pontos em um plano para que não haja concavidades na linha . Mais formalmente, podemos descrevê -lo como o menor polígono convexo que envolve um conjunto de pontos de modo que cada ponto no conjunto esteja dentro do polígono ou no seu perímetro.

Como você encontra o ponto de um casco convexo?

Calcule a mediana x coordenada do conjunto de pontos (xmid). Desenhe uma linha vertical nesse ponto. Partição P em L e R sobre esse ponto. Nosso objetivo será encontrar a borda convexa do casco que cruzará essa linha y = xmid .

Qual é o outro nome para um problema de casco rápido?

Explicação: O outro nome para o problema do casco rápido é Problema do casco convexo , enquanto o problema mais próximo do par é o problema de encontrar a distância mais próxima entre dois pontos.

O Hull convexo é duro?

O problema é NP-Hard; Veja minha resposta no MathOverflow. Portanto, não existe um certificado de tamanho polinomial de que a bola da unidade esteja contida no casco convexo de pontos dados, a menos que np = co-np (se np = co-np, então a hierarquia polinomial colapsa).

Qual é a utilidade do casco convexo?

O casco convexo é uma estrutura onipresente na geometria computacional . Embora seja uma ferramenta útil por si só, também é útil na construção de outras estruturas como os diagramas Voronoi e em aplicações como análise de imagem não supervisionada.

Como é um convexo?

Uma forma convexa é o oposto de uma forma côncava. ele se curva para fora e seu meio é mais espesso que suas bordas . Se você pegar uma bola de futebol ou um rugby e colocar -a como se estivesse prestes a chutar, verá que ela tem uma forma convexa – suas pontas são pontudas e tem um meio grosso.

Como o casco convexo funciona?

O casco convexo de um simples polígono envolve o polígono dado e é particionado por regiões , uma das quais é o próprio polígono. As outras regiões, delimitadas por uma cadeia poligonal do polígono e uma única borda do casco convexo, são chamadas de bolsos.

Por que o Scipy é usado em Python?

Scipy em Python é uma biblioteca de código aberto usado para resolver problemas matemáticos, científicos, de engenharia e técnicos . Ele permite que os usuários manipulem os dados e visualizem os dados usando uma ampla gama de comandos Python de alto nível. Scipy é construído na extensão Python Numpy.

Como instalo o Scipy Spatial?

Podemos instalar a biblioteca SCIPY usando comando pip ; Execute o seguinte comando no terminal: pip install scipy.

O que é um voronoi cume?

As cristas de Voronoi são perpendiculares às linhas desenhadas entre os pontos de entrada . Para os quais dois pontos corresponde a cada cume.

Para que serve um diagrama de Voronoi?

Os diagramas

Voronoi têm aplicações em quase todas as áreas da ciência e engenharia. estruturas biológicas podem ser descritas usando -as. Na aviação, eles são usados ??para identificar o aeroporto mais próximo em caso de diversões. Na mineração, eles podem ajudar a estimativa de recursos minerais gerais com base em furos exploratórios.

Advertisements

Como você sabe se uma figura é convexa?

Se nossa forma for um polígono, também podemos determinar se é convexo por olhando para seus ângulos interiores . Se cada um de seus ângulos internos for menor ou igual a 180 graus, o polígono será convexo. As funções também podem ser classificadas como convexas quando sua inclinação está aumentando.

Como você sabe se uma forma é côncava ou convexa?

Um polígono convexo não tem um denas na forma, enquanto um polígono côncavo tem um lado da forma em direção ao interior da forma. Os ângulos internos de um polígono convexo são inferiores a 180 °, enquanto os ângulos em um polígono côncavo são mais de 180 °.

Como você diz se um espelho é côncavo ou convexo?

Para descobrir o que os sinais significam, pegue o lado do espelho onde o objeto deve ser o lado positivo. Quaisquer distâncias medidas desse lado são positivas. As distâncias medidas do outro lado são negativas. f, a distância focal, é positiva para um espelho côncavo e negativo para um espelho convexo.

é um círculo um casco convexo?

Os interiores dos círculos e de todos os polígonos regulares são convexos, mas um círculo em si não é porque todo segmento que une dois pontos no círculo contém pontos que não estão no círculo.

Como você resolve um problema de casco convexo?

Dado o conjunto de pontos para os quais precisamos encontrar o casco convexo. Suponha que conheçamos o casco convexo dos meio pontos esquerdos e da metade direita, então o problema agora é mesclar esses dois cascos convexos e determinar o casco convexo para o conjunto completo. Que o casco convexo esquerdo seja A e o casco convexo direito seja b.

O que é o conjunto convexo com o exemplo?

Equivalentemente, um conjunto convexo ou uma região convexa é um subconjunto que cruza cada linha em um segmento de linha única (possivelmente vazia). Por exemplo, Um cubo sólido é um conjunto convexo, mas qualquer coisa que seja oca ou com um recuo, por exemplo, uma forma crescente, não é convexa.

Qual é o caso médio e a pior complexidade do tempo do algoritmo convexo do casco?

Quickhull é um método de calcular o casco convexo de um conjunto finito de pontos no plano. Ele usa uma abordagem de divisão e conquista semelhante à do Quicksort, do qual seu nome deriva. Sua complexidade média de casos é considerada como î (n * log (n)), enquanto no pior caso é necessário O (n^2) .

Qual algoritmo é usado para convencer o casco?

O algoritmo usado aqui é a varredura de Graham (proposta em 1972 por Graham) com melhorias de Andrew (1979). O algoritmo permite a construção de um casco convexo em O (nLogn) usando apenas operações de comparação, adição e multiplicação.

Qual é a complexidade média de caso de um algoritmo convexo do casco * 1 ponto?

algoritmos convexos de casco requerem o (n 2) tempo, em média; Para algumas das distribuições, o tempo linear é suficiente.

Qual é o método mais seguro para escolher um elemento pivô?

Explicação: O melhor método para selecionar um elemento pivô aceitável é particionamento mediano de três anos . Escolher um pivô entre os elementos do primeiro, último ou aleatório é ineficaz.

Qual é o princípio básico no algoritmo Rabin Karp?

Explicação: O princípio básico empregado no algoritmo Rabin Karp é hash . No texto dado, cada substring é convertida em um valor de hash e comparada com o valor de hash do padrão.